Definition
  1. Verb phrase:
    • To close (one's eyes) tightly: To shut one's eyelids firmly and completely, often implying a deliberate, forceful, or sustained action.
Usage Examples
  • Verb phrase:
    • Cậu nhắm nghiền mắt lại sợ hãi. (The boy closed his eyes tightly because he was scared.)
    • ấy nhắm nghiền mắt để tập trung. (She closed her eyes tightly to concentrate.)
    • Anh ấy chỉ muốn nhắm nghiền mắt ngủ. (He just wanted to close his eyes tightly and sleep.)
Advanced Usage
  • "nhắm nghiền mắt lại": This is the most common and complete construction. The phrase almost always includes "mắt" (eyes) and often "lại" (an action particle indicating completion or direction).
    • nhắm nghiền mắt lại, cố gắng không nhìn xuống. (He closed his eyes tightly, trying not to look down.)
Variants and Related Words
  • Nhắm mắt (verb phrase): To close one's eyes. This is the neutral, standard term.
    • Nhắm mắt thư giãn. (Close your eyes and relax.)
  • Nhắm tịt (verb phrase, informal): To close (eyes) tightly. Similar to "nhắm nghiền" but can sound more casual or childish.
    • Đứa trẻ nhắm tịt mắt lại. (The child squeezed its eyes shut.)
Synonyms
  • Nhắm chặt (verb phrase): To close tightly. A close synonym, though "nhắm nghiền" often carries a more vivid, descriptive nuance.
Notes on Meaning
  • The word "nghiền" in this context intensifies the verb "nhắm" (to close). It conveys an image of pressing or squeezing the eyelids together, not just gently closing them. It is often used to describe reactions to strong light, pain, intense concentration, fear, or a deep desire to block out the external world.
